Step 4: FD leak hunt. Build your plugin against Quillgate 3.2, then run the harness with descriptor tracking on. Watch the fd count across 500 load/unload cycles; growth over 2% fails the gate. Common culprits: unclosed pipe readers, forgotten inotify watches, sockets held by cached clients. Fix, rerun, and attach the harness log to your submission. Submissions must be signed before the Quillgate registry will accept them, and signing requires the plugin deploy key, which is listed directly below.

deploy key for kajof-fajop: bky6_gDHw9Q

Action Item PM-7: Flaky DNS in Thornbury cluster

Reviewer, please verify this change adds a local caching resolver to the Kestrel sidecar and bumps the retry budget from two to five with jitter. The intermittent lookup failures during the Ashgrove incident traced back to upstream resolver restarts. Context, packet captures, and the accepted design rationale are collected on the investigation page:

operations page: https://jenkins.zemvarcloud.local/job/merge_requests/repo/build/73930b4b30f0a8ed

Runbook — account recovery, tailcli (Fernhollow log tailer). If your tailcli session token expires mid-incident, run the recover subcommand from the jump host. It prompts twice; answer with your handle, then the team slug. Never reuse an old token file. When prompted for the vault unlock, enter the recovery passphrase shown below.

recovery phrase for bawep-kawef: oliath-casdor

Dependency pinning at Thornebury Labs, the short version: everything in the Quillstack monorepo is pinned to exact versions, lockfiles are committed, and floating ranges get flagged by CI. If you're reviewing and spot a caret or tilde in a manifest, that's a policy violation — file it. Upgrades land through the weekly bump job, never by hand. To pull the pinning report from our compliance endpoint during your review, authenticate using the bearer token below.

login token, bagug-kafop: eyJhbGciOiJIUzI1NiIsInR5cCI6IkpXVCJ9.eyJzdWIiOiIcMLov2In0.Z5RLDIfp